Infrastructure Requirements for EV Charging Stations at Workplaces

The adoption of electric vehicles (EVs) is accelerating, and alongside that growth, the need for widespread and accessible charging infrastructure is increasingly critical. With a considerable portion of an individual’s life spent at work, employers have a unique opportunity to support the transition to electric mobility by installing EV charging stations in their workplaces. This move not only benefits employees who own EVs by providing them with convenience and confidence in their vehicle’s range but also reflects well on the company’s commitment to sustainability and corporate responsibility.

Infrastructure requirements for EV charging stations at workplaces entail a multifaceted approach involving practical, technical, and regulatory considerations. From a practical standpoint, employers must assess the demand for charging points, which depends on the current and projected number of EV drivers. This helps discover the scale of the installation required, whether it includes Level 1, Level 2, or DC fast charging stations, which vary significantly in charge speed and infrastructure demands.

Technically, it’s essential to evaluate the available electrical capacity of the site. In some cases, upgrading the power supply might be necessary to accommodate the added load from chargers without impacting the existing demand for electricity in the workplace. Drawing up a site map to determine optimal locations for the stations is key to maximizing their usage while considering aspects such as convenience, cable management, and parking space configuration.

On the regulatory side, adherence to local building codes, electrical standards, and zoning regulations is mandatory. It’s often required to work closely with utility companies and local governments to ensure compliance and potentially take advantage of any grants or incentives offered for installing green infrastructure. Additionally, the Americans with Disabilities Act (ADA) and other relevant standards might dictate specific requirements for accessibility, which must be incorporated into the design and layout of the charging station area.

Lastly, advancing toward a greener workplace involves considering the integration of smart technologies for charging station management. Features like usage tracking, real-time monitoring, and scheduling capabilities allow organizations to optimize energy use and possibly incorporate dynamic pricing to manage demand.

Integration of Renewable Energy for Sustainable EV Charging

The integration of renewable energy to power Electric Vehicle (EV) charging stations is a critical step towards developing sustainable EV charging solutions and reducing the carbon footprint associated with transportation. As the workplace begins to transition to more environmentally-friendly practices, the incorporation of clean energy sources like solar and wind to power EV charging stations is gaining momentum.

Renewable energy sources can directly supply the electricity needed to charge EVs, thereby ensuring that the vehicles are truly green, operating not just on electricity but on clean electricity. This not only helps in reducing reliance on fossil fuels but also supports the grid in managing the increased demand resulting from EVs without contributing to greenhouse gas emissions.

The use of renewable energy sources for EV charging can take different forms. For example, solar panels can be installed on the rooftops of workplaces or as covers for parking lots. These installations not only generate electricity but also provide shade and protection for the vehicles being charged. Additionally, wind turbines can supply power to the grid or directly to charging infrastructure if the geographic location is amenable to wind energy generation.

For many companies, the switch to renewable-powered EV charging stations is also good for their public image as it shows commitment to sustainability and corporate responsibility. This can positively affect customer perception and also attract and retain employees who value environmental consciousness in their employer.

Integrating renewable energy into EV charging also presents an economic advantage in the long term. Investments in renewable energy resources can lead to reduced operating costs as the price of solar panels and wind turbines continues to decrease and their efficiency increases. Additionally, in some areas, there are financial incentives available for businesses that install renewable energy systems, further enhancing the fiscal appeal.

EV Charging Station Incentives and Policies for Employers

Electric Vehicle (EV) charging stations are becoming an increasingly common sight in many workplaces, as employers strive to support greener commuting habits and to reduce the carbon footprint of their operations. The installation and maintenance of these charging stations are bolstered by various incentives and policies directed at employers.

One of the main drivers for employers to install EV charging stations is the potential for governmental incentives. These can come in the form of tax credits, rebates, or grants. For example, the U.S. federal government, through the Alternative Fuel Infrastructure Tax Credit, allows a tax credit for up to 30% of the cost of installing EV charging facilities. Some state and local governments provide additional incentives, such as reduced utility rates for electricity used in EV charging, or even direct funding to cover installation costs. These financial incentives can significantly lower the barrier to entry for employers considering the addition of EV charging options at their workplaces.

In addition to financial incentives, other policies can encourage employers to install charging stations. These include mandates or zoning regulations that require new or renovated buildings to include EV charging infrastructure or to dedicate a certain percentage of parking spaces to EV charging. Such regulations not only promote the initial installation of charging stations but also ensure that future developments will continue to support the growth of electric vehicle use.

### User Accessibility and Management of Workplace Charging Points

User accessibility and management are crucial aspects of implementing electric vehicle (EV) charging stations in the workplace. As we transition toward green energy solutions, businesses are increasingly looking to install EV charging points as part of their commitment to sustainability and to accommodate the growing number of employees who drive EVs.

Ease of access to charging points is a primary concern. Employees who need to charge their EVs during work hours require a system that allows them to do so without hassle. This implies seamless integration into existing parking lots or structures, with clear signage and dedicated spaces for EVs to ensure that the charging stations are both visible and physically accessible.

Effective management of these charging stations includes setting up a booking system or a queue management system to ensure fair usage among EV-driving employees. This is especially important during peak hours or in workplaces with a limited number of charging points. Companies may use software solutions that allow employees to reserve a charging slot in advance, thereby eliminating potential conflicts and ensuring that the facility is used efficiently.

Furthermore, the administration of workplace charging stations often entails establishing transparent policies to govern their use. This might include deciding who can use the stations (employees only or the public as well), setting appropriate charging fees if applicable, and determining how to allocate costs for energy consumption — options include company-subsidized, employee-paid, or a hybrid of the two.

Maintenance is another integral part of managing workplace EV charging stations. Regular servicing ensures that charging points remain in good working order and are safe to use. Additionally, businesses must stay informed about the latest advancements in EV charging technology to potentially upgrade their infrastructure and provide faster or more efficient charging options as they become available.

Monitoring and Reducing the Carbon Footprint of Corporate Fleets through EV Adoption

Corporate fleets are a significant contributor to carbon emissions globally, given that they consist of vehicles that are often in use for the majority of any given day, whether for transporting goods or employees. Monitoring and reducing the carbon footprint of these fleets is both a responsibility and a challenge for companies aiming to enhance their sustainability profiles. Electric Vehicle (EV) adoption serves as a pivotal strategy in achieving greener operations by replacing regular internal combustion engine vehicles with low-emission counterparts.

Adopting EVs into corporate fleets has the potential to substantially reduce greenhouse gas emissions associated with business operations. EVs produce zero tailpipe emissions, which directly lowers the amount of nitrogen oxides, particulate matter, and hydrocarbons being released into the atmosphere, improving local air quality in addition to contributing to global emission reduction targets.

However, monitoring and effectively managing the transition to a cleaner fleet requires a well-thought-out strategy. It involves assessing the current carbon footprint of the fleet, setting realistic targets for reduction, selecting appropriate EV models suitable for various operational needs, and finally, ensuring the support infrastructure, notably EV charging stations, is in place at the workplace.

To facilitate the monitoring process, companies can employ telematics systems that provide real-time data on fleet performance, including fuel consumption, vehicle diagnostics, and driver behavior. This data can help in making informed decisions about the operation and maintenance of the fleet, leading to optimized routes and schedules that can further reduce emissions.

When it comes to EV charging stations, they play a crucial role in the adoption of EVs within corporate fleets. Workplaces can install these charging points to provide employees with the convenience of charging their company vehicles during working hours. This not only encourages the use of EVs but also ensures that the vehicles are ready for operation with minimal downtime.
